aboutsummaryrefslogtreecommitdiff
path: root/sim
diff options
context:
space:
mode:
authorMike Frysinger <vapier@gentoo.org>2010-03-30 23:43:03 +0000
committerMike Frysinger <vapier@gentoo.org>2010-03-30 23:43:03 +0000
commit4e9586f0dc68911caa04d2a23967b6892576f56c (patch)
tree77744b5623a6aa23877fccc19224dbfd9b6fe2b5 /sim
parentb36562f693df03c18beb1b84ec991c2f2d0e5c1c (diff)
downloadfsf-binutils-gdb-4e9586f0dc68911caa04d2a23967b6892576f56c.zip
fsf-binutils-gdb-4e9586f0dc68911caa04d2a23967b6892576f56c.tar.gz
fsf-binutils-gdb-4e9586f0dc68911caa04d2a23967b6892576f56c.tar.bz2
sim: v850: fix build failure after watchpoint constification
Diffstat (limited to 'sim')
-rw-r--r--sim/v850/ChangeLog5
-rw-r--r--sim/v850/interp.c4
2 files changed, 7 insertions, 2 deletions
diff --git a/sim/v850/ChangeLog b/sim/v850/ChangeLog
index 0e01705..4d43d3e 100644
--- a/sim/v850/ChangeLog
+++ b/sim/v850/ChangeLog
@@ -1,3 +1,8 @@
+2010-03-30 Mike Frysinger <vapier@gentoo.org>
+
+ * interp.c (interrupt_names): Add const to pointer type.
+ (do_interrupt): Add const to interrupt_name.
+
2010-01-09 Ralf Wildenhues <Ralf.Wildenhues@gmx.de>
* configure: Regenerate.
diff --git a/sim/v850/interp.c b/sim/v850/interp.c
index 1ca248c..e8bea5f 100644
--- a/sim/v850/interp.c
+++ b/sim/v850/interp.c
@@ -48,7 +48,7 @@ enum interrupt_type
num_int_types
};
-char *interrupt_names[] = {
+const char *interrupt_names[] = {
"reset",
"nmi",
"intov1",
@@ -65,7 +65,7 @@ do_interrupt (sd, data)
SIM_DESC sd;
void *data;
{
- char **interrupt_name = (char**)data;
+ const char **interrupt_name = (const char**)data;
enum interrupt_type inttype;
inttype = (interrupt_name - STATE_WATCHPOINTS (sd)->interrupt_names);